package triton
import (
"errors"
"strings"
"github.com/hashicorp/terraform/helper/schema"
"github.com/joyent/triton-go"
)
func resourceKey() *schema.Resource {
return &schema.Resource{
Create: resourceKeyCreate,
Exists: resourceKeyExists,
Read: resourceKeyRead,
Delete: resourceKeyDelete,
Timeouts: fastResourceTimeout,
Importer: &schema.ResourceImporter{
State: schema.ImportStatePassthrough,
},
Schema: map[string]*schema.Schema{
"name": {
Description: "Name of the key (generated from the key comment if not set)",
Type: schema.TypeString,
Optional: true,
Computed: true,
ForceNew: true,
},
"key": {
Description: "Content of public key from disk in OpenSSH format",
Type: schema.TypeString,
Required: true,
ForceNew: true,
},
},
}
}
func resourceKeyCreate(d *schema.ResourceData, meta interface{}) error {
client := meta.(*triton.Client)
if keyName := d.Get("name").(string); keyName == "" {
parts := strings.SplitN(d.Get("key").(string), " ", 3)
if len(parts) == 3 {
d.Set("name", parts[2])
} else {
return errors.New("No key name specified, and key material has no comment")
}
}
_, err := client.Keys().CreateKey(&triton.CreateKeyInput{
Name: d.Get("name").(string),
Key: d.Get("key").(string),
})
if err != nil {
return err
}
d.SetId(d.Get("name").(string))
return resourceKeyRead(d, meta)
}
func resourceKeyExists(d *schema.ResourceData, meta interface{}) (bool, error) {
client := meta.(*triton.Client)
_, err := client.Keys().GetKey(&triton.GetKeyInput{
KeyName: d.Id(),
})
if err != nil {
return false, err
}
return true, nil
}
func resourceKeyRead(d *schema.ResourceData, meta interface{}) error {
client := meta.(*triton.Client)
key, err := client.Keys().GetKey(&triton.GetKeyInput{
KeyName: d.Id(),
})
if err != nil {
return err
}
d.Set("name", key.Name)
d.Set("key", key.Key)
return nil
}
func resourceKeyDelete(d *schema.ResourceData, meta interface{}) error {
client := meta.(*triton.Client)
return client.Keys().DeleteKey(&triton.DeleteKeyInput{
KeyName: d.Id(),
})
}
